1. Transfer Photos, Videos & Music between Samsung and PC via Copy & Paste

1. Connect your Samsung device with your PC via a USB cable. Once the connection is enabled, you should choose the Media Device MTP from the prompt.

Transfer folder manager download

2. Turn to the left bottom of your computer screen and click the Windows logo, then, click the folder-shaped icon in the lower-left side of the Start window. This will open the File Explorer program.

3. Click the name of your Samsung phone from the left side bar of the File Explorer and click to open it.

4. Decide to choose the 'Internal Storage' or the 'SD card' folder according to where your media files are saved.

5. Open the folder labeled 'DCIM' where your photos and videos are stored. By the way, you should find other folders if your media files are not all in the DCIM folder.

6. Now, you can select the photos, videos and other more media files you want to move to your computer and copy and paste them to your computer. You can create a folder on your computer to save the transferred files.

7. If you want to copy files from computer to Samsung phone, you can select the files, copy them and paste to the Camera folder (or other folder where your media files are in) on your Samsung phone.

How to View iPhone Files on Computer via iTunes

To view iPhone files using iTunes the following steps will guide you.

Transfer Folder Manager Windows 10

Step 1: Start your computer and launch iTunes on it. Ensure you use a lighting cable to plug your iPhone into the computer.
Step 2: Click on the device tab at the upper left corner. On the left sidebard, you will see On My Device.
Step 3: Now, select the type of file to view the corresponding files.

Cons:

  • iTunes only allows you to view iPhone music, movies, TV shows, books, audiobooks, and tones. And that’s all.
  • iTunes only allows you to view the iPhone files but cannot allow you to manage them.
  • iTunes may not detect some files which have been imported into your iDevice without iTunes.
